Even the two level basement was elaborate including a three-lane bowling alley, jewelry vault, huge laundry and drying rooms and a monster coal storage room with a double boiler system. The home was originally built in 1899 as a vacation home for Otto Young at a cost exceeding one million dollars, then sold for as little as $10,000 (and some back taxes) at auction in 1954. The riches came by investing the jewelry profits into downtown real estate, a procedure that was made economical by the bargains that followed the Chicago fire. Originally called Younglands when it was completed in 1901, the exterior of this Italian-inspired design remains virtually unchanged. It was the 50-room cottage of Chicagoans Otto and Ann Young, designed for them by Henry Lord Gay and built in 1901.
